Export sops extended to auto sector
News Behind The News
 
September 29, 2008



In a bid to boost automobile exports, the Union Government on Thursday last extended incentives to the sector by adding cars and two-wheelers of certain specifications under the market linked focus products category. Items of high export intensity but low penetration in particular countries enjoy the benefit of import duty credit equivalent to 1.25 per cent of the freight-on-board value of exports under the market linked focus products category.



The Directorate General of Foreign Trade said passenger cars with engine capacities of up 1,500 cc have been placed under the market linked focus products category for exports to countries including Russia, Singapore, the Philippines, Pakistan, Saudi Arabia, the UAE and Turkey.



The notice also said two-wheelers, including mopeds, not exceeding engine displacement of 500cc have also been extended the export benefit for shipments to Nigeria, Indonesia, Kenya, Tanzania, Mexico, Singapore, South Africa and Egypt.



The announcement comes after Commerce and Industry Minister Kamal Nath’s assurance earlier this month at the annual convention of the Society of Indian Automobile Manufacturers that the Government was looking to give a boost to the sector by putting it under the focus market scheme.
